HVAC thermostat rep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ues with the device that controls a heating, ventilation, and air conditioning system. These services typically include troubleshooting problems such as unresponsive or inaccurate temperature readings, malfunctioning displays, or thermostats that won’t turn the system on or off properly. Skilled technicians can replace faulty components, recalibrate the thermostat, or upgrade outdated models to ensure the system responds accurately to temperature settings. Proper repair helps maintain consistent comfort levels inside the property and prevents unnecessary energy consumption caused by malfunctioning thermostats.

Many common problems that lead homeowners to seek thermostat repair include inconsistent heating or cooling, digital display errors, or situations where the thermostat appears to be working but the system does not respond. Sometimes, the issue may be as simple as dead batteries or loose wiring, but other times it may involve more complex electronic failures or sensor problems. Repair services help resolve these issues efficiently, restoring proper control over the HVAC system and improving overall energy efficiency. Addressing thermostat problems early can also prevent further damage to the HVAC system and reduce the risk of costly replacements.

The overview below groups typical Hvac Thermostat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most routine thermostat repairs, such as sensor replacements or wiring fixes, typically cost between $150 and $300. These projects are common and usually fall within the lower to mid-range price band.

Thermostat Replacement - Replacing an outdated or malfunctioning thermostat generally ranges from $250 to $600, depending on the model and installation complexity. Many jobs in this category are completed within this middle price range.

Full System Tune-Ups - Comprehensive thermostat system tune-ups or calibration services often cost between $300 and $800. Larger, more complex projects can push costs higher but are less frequent.

Complete System Replacement - Replacing an entire HVAC control system or upgrading to a smart thermostat can range from $1,500 to over $3,500. These larger projects are less common but represent the higher end of typical costs handled by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a thermostat needs repair? Signs include inconsistent heating or cooling, the thermostat not responding to adjustments, or displaying incorrect temperatures, indicating it may require professional repair.

Can a faulty thermostat affect my HVAC system's performance? Yes, a malfunctioning thermostat can cause your HVAC system to operate inefficiently, leading to uneven temperatures and increased energy usage.

What types of thermostat issues can local contractors typically fix? They can address problems such as calibration errors, wiring issues, display malfunctions, or sensor failures that impact thermostat operation.

Is it necessary to replace my thermostat if it stops working? Not always; many issues can be repaired. A local service provider can assess whether repair or replacement is the best solution.
